In this podcast, the host explores the profound significance of the prayer "Az Yashir Moshe uvnei Yisrael," a song sung by the Jewish people after the miraculous splitting of the Yam Suf (Red Sea). This prayer is considered the pinnacle of Pesukei Dezimra, symbolizing gratitude and recognition of God's omnipotence. The host emphasizes the importance of reciting it while standing, connecting it to the intense moment of witnessing the miracle. The discussion delves into the essence of song in Judaism, highlighting that true song transcends time and space, linking past struggles to future hopes. The podcast also reflects on personal challenges and the transformative power of prayer, drawing on the teachings of various sages. Through storytelling, it illustrates how joy and melody can emerge even in difficult circumstances, encapsulating the deep relationship between song, prayer, and the Jewish spirit.
